Getting there

By public transportation one has to reach the UBahn station
Universität
or the bus station Universität (UBahn map attached)


https://indico.cern.ch/event/442634/picture/9.png


1. Coming from the airport: Take S1/S8 (there is only one direction,
towards downtown, as the airport is a terminal station).  Change at
Marienplatz (the old city center and the townhall square) to the U6
direction north (Fröttmaning/Garching/Garching Forschungszentrum) or U3
direction Olympiazentrum.
Exit the train at the station Universität. The
exit is at Ludwigstrasse and (depending on the exact exit - one should
look for the one indicating Schellingstrasse) about 3-4min on foot to
the venue

2. Coming from the main train station (Hauptbahnhof), one has to take
any S line to Marienplatz and then change to U6 or U3 and follow the
above instructions. Alternatively, one can also take from the main
station the U4 direction Arabellapark or U5 direction Neuperlach, change
at Odeonsplatz to U3/U6 and follow the instruction from point 1

Public Transportation

- Public transportation in Munich is expensive and every now and then
they increase the prices even more. The idea of the system is to
encourage people to buy more longterm cards. A single ride with the
UBahn for more than 2 stations costs 2.70Euros. A single ride for one or
two stations 1.30Euros. Unless people are within walking distance or up
to two stations away, I would suggest buying a weekly card for two rings
(it depends of course where their hotel is located). It costs
14.10Euros, which is about the price of 5 single tickets. There are also
more complicated options such as group tickets, but better avoid
confusing people with that.
